Does the Huawei Pura 70 Pro support eSIM?
Huawei Pura 70 Pro eSIM compatibility
Yes, the Huawei Pura 70 Pro supports eSIM on international variants. If you purchased your device outside mainland China, you can activate and use an eSIM alongside a physical nano-SIM card. China-market models may differ in eSIM availability, so if you bought your Pura 70 Pro in China, check your device's SIM settings or consult Huawei's official specifications to confirm eSIM support for your specific variant.
Dual SIM with eSIM and physical SIM
The Huawei Pura 70 Pro offers dual SIM functionality: one physical nano-SIM slot and one eSIM. You can use both simultaneously, which makes it simple to keep your home number active for calls and texts while adding a travel eSIM for mobile data abroad. The device does not support dual eSIM operation—you'll always need the physical SIM if you want two lines active at once.
How to set up an eSIM on the Huawei Pura 70 Pro
Set up an eSIM in Settings
Installing an eSIM on your Huawei Pura 70 Pro takes about 60 seconds. You'll need a Wi-Fi connection and the QR code from your eSIM provider. Follow these steps to activate your eSIM:
- Open Settings and tap Mobile network (or SIM management, depending on your EMUI/HarmonyOS version).
- Tap SIM management or eSIM, then select Add eSIM or Add mobile plan.
- Scan the QR code provided by your eSIM carrier using your device's camera.
- Wait while your Pura 70 Pro downloads and installs the eSIM profile—this usually completes within a minute.
- Label your new eSIM line (e.g., "Travel" or "Data") so you can identify it easily in settings.
- Choose which line to use for mobile data, calls, and SMS in the SIM management menu.
Once activated, your eSIM appears alongside your physical SIM in the mobile network settings. You can switch between lines or turn either SIM on or off at any time.
Using a travel eSIM on the Huawei Pura 70 Pro
Stay connected abroad without roaming fees
A travel eSIM is the easiest way to get mobile data when you're traveling internationally. Instead of paying roaming charges on your home plan or hunting for a local SIM card at the airport, you install a data-only eSIM before you fly. Your Huawei Pura 70 Pro will connect to a local network as soon as you land, and you'll keep your primary number active for incoming calls and two-factor authentication codes.
Install your travel eSIM while you're still at home and connected to Wi-Fi. Most eSIM plans activate automatically when you arrive in your destination country, so you won't need to find a SIM vendor or navigate a foreign carrier store. Tips & troubleshooting
Enable data roaming for your eSIM line
After you install a travel eSIM, go to Settings > Mobile network and select your eSIM line. Turn on Data roaming for that line—despite the name, you won't incur roaming fees because the eSIM connects you directly to a local network. Also confirm that Mobile data is assigned to your eSIM in the SIM management menu, so your Pura 70 Pro uses the travel plan for internet access.
Keep your home SIM active for calls and texts
Set your primary physical SIM as the default line for voice calls and SMS. This way, you'll receive calls and verification codes on your usual number while the eSIM handles data. You can toggle each line on or off independently, which is useful if you want to avoid any roaming charges on your home SIM—just disable its mobile data while leaving calls and texts enabled.
Fix an eSIM that won't activate
If the QR code won't scan, check that your camera lens is clean and you're holding the phone steady at the right distance. You can also enter the activation code manually: tap Enter activation code manually during setup and type in the SM-DP+ address and activation code from your eSIM provider's email. If the eSIM profile installs but won't connect, restart your Pura 70 Pro and confirm you've enabled data roaming for the eSIM line.
